Let’s cut to the chase: In December 2023, Windhoek made history by launching Namibia’s first grid-scale energy storage system. This 54MWh project in Erongo Region isn’t just a battery installation – it’s a game-changer for a country where 70% of electricity was imported pre-2023[1]. Ever tried running a business with just 2 hours of electricity a day? Welcome to Lebanon! With electricity prices soaring to $1.5 per kWh – nearly 30% of an average worker’s monthly income – the country has become ground zero for energy storage solutions[1]. When we talk about "deflating" a reservoir, we're not discussing giant pool toys. In hydraulic engineering terms, this refers to controlled water release or drainage to reduce reservoir levels.
